Step 1: Leak Detection
We use specialized equipment to detect even the smallest leaks, including mo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ras. We’ll identify the source of the leak and find out the extent of the damage so we can develop a plan to fix it. This process usually takes about 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the area affected.
Step 2: Containment
Once we’ve located the leak, we’ll set up a containment system to prevent further water dam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and prevent it from spreading to other parts of your home keeping your belongings safe.
Step 3: Drying
After we’ve removed the water,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ry the affected area. We’ll use a combination of air movers and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process and prevent m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Repair
Once the area is dry, we’ll repair the slab leak and any other damage caused by the leak. We’ll use high-quality materials and our technicians will be on site to ensure the job is done right so you can trust that the repair will last.
Step 5: Inspection and Testing
After the repair is complete, we’ll inspect the area to ensure everything is dry and safe. We’ll test the slab to make sure it’s secure and provide you with a written report so you can have peace of mind.

Warning Signs You Need Slab Leak Water Removal
Catching slab leaks early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s, not to mention the hassle and stress of dealing with the situation. Here are some common signs that show you need slab leak water removal in your New Port Richey, FL home.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, musty odors in your home can be a sign of a slab leak. These odors are often caused by mold and mildew growth which can spread quickly if not addressed.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Floors
Water stains on your ceiling or floors can show a slab leak. These stains can be caused by water seeping through the slab and can lead to further damage if not addressed.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a slab leak. This can be caused by water damage which can compromise the structural integrity of your home.
Increased Water Bills
Increased water bills can be a sign of a slab leak. This can be caused by water constantly flowing through the slab and can lead to a significant increase in your water bills.
Noisy Pipes
Noisy pipes can be a sign of a slab leak. This can be caused by water flowing through the pipes and can show a leak or other issue.
Mineral Deposits on Your Sinks or Showers
Mineral deposits on your sinks or showers can be a sign of a slab leak. This can be caused by mineral-rich water flowing through the pipes and can lead to damage to your fixtures and appliances.

Slab Leak Water Removal Cost In New Port Richey, FL
The cost of slab leak water removal in New Port Richey, FL can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in your property.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ment so you know exactly what to expect. Our prices are competitive and based on the severity of the damage so you can trust that you’re getting a fair deal.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Leak detection | $200-$1,000 | Size and complexity of the leak |
| Water extraction | $500-$2,500 | Amount of water extracted |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000-$5,000 | Size of the affected area |
| Slab repair | $1,500-$10,000 | Size and complexity of the repair |
| Inspections and testing | $200-$1,000 | Frequency and scope of inspections |
| More services (e.g. Mold remediation, carpet drying) | $500-$5,000 | Severity and extent of more damage |
